Synopsis "Pro Calendario Gregoriano Disputatio (1585) (in Latin)"
Pro Calendario Gregoriano Disputatio est liber Petri Roest, qui anno MDLXXXV editus est. In hoc libro, Roest argumenta pro adoptione Calendarii Gregoriani, quod anno MDLII Papa Gregorius XIII instituit. Roest disputat contra eos, qui Calendario Iuliano utuntur, et ostendit rationes, cur Calendarius Gregorianus melior sit. In hoc libro, Roest etiam describit historiam Calendarii et eius mutationes a tempore Caesaris Iulii Caesaris usque ad tempora Gregorii XIII.
